Moonbeam, I'm 60 my wife is 58. We both love the vehicle and have no problems with blind spots or getting in and out. My daughter has an Element and I would say the interior storage space is slightly bigger in the FJ. The gas milage is slightly better in the Element but not much. Test drive one (see if the dealer will give it to you for the weekend) and make your decision. Good luck and welcome the the forum.
